So, what is monobasic sodium phosphate?
Monobasic sodium phosphate is a food ingredient commonly used as an emulsifier, pH buffer, and thickener. It is a white crystalline powder that is highly soluble in water and has a slightly salty taste. Monobasic sodium phosphate is often added to processed foods such as canned soups and meats, dairy products, and baked goods to enhance their texture, improve their shelf life, and stabilize their pH levels. Although there are no significant health risks associated with consuming monobasic sodium phosphate in moderate amounts, excessive intake may cause digestive discomfort and other adverse effects.
